Cefalu

Cefalu is a fishing village and beach resort that is located on the northern coast of Sicily, Italy. It sits on the Tyerrhenian Sea and is just 70 kilometers from Palermo and 185 kilometers from Messina. The town has a small population of under 14,000 residents but is a significant tourist destination on the island of Sicily. The city is flooded with millions of tourists every year from around Sicily, elsewhere in Italy, and abroad. During the summer months it is not uncommon for the city's population to triple, putting a lot of pressure on the main streets and roads around town. The city is popular as a beach resort with a youthful vibe and an active nightlife.

Santander

Santander is the capital of the Cantabria Region which runs along the northern coast of Spain. Located right on the bay, it is a place of many historic churches and a handful of interesting museums that range from archaeological discoveries of the region, to maritime history, and cultural features like bullfighting. There is also a large selection of beaches for those looking for a more relaxing getaway in the sun and sand.

Which place is cheaper, Santander or Cefalu?

These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ations.

The average daily cost (per person) in Cefalu is €119, while the average daily cost in Santander is €108.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. What follows is a categorical breakdown of travel costs for Cefalu and Santander in more detail.

When is the best time to visit Cefalu or Santander?

Both places have a temperate climate with four distinct seasons. As both cities are in the northern hemisphere, summer is in July and winter is in January.

Should I visit Cefalu or Santander in the Summer?

Both Santander and Cefalu during the summer are popular places to visit. Many travelers come to Cefalu for the beaches, the hiking, the small town charm, and the family-friendly experiences.

In the summer, Cefalu is a little warmer than Santander. Typically, the summer temperatures in Cefalu in July average around 26°C (79°F), and Santander averages at about 19°C (66°F).

In Santander, it's very sunny this time of the year. It's quite sunny in Cefalu. In the summer, Cefalu often gets more sunshine than Santander. Cefalu gets 325 hours of sunny skies this time of year, while Santander receives 213 hours of full sun.

Cefalu usually gets less rain in July than Santander. Cefalu gets 2 mm (0.1 in) of rain, while Santander receives 50 mm (2 in) of rain this time of the year.

Should I visit Cefalu or Santander in the Autumn?

The autumn attracts plenty of travelers to both Cefalu and Santander. Many visitors come to Cefalu in the autumn for the hiking trails, the shopping scene, the small town atmosphere, and the natural beauty of the area.

In October, Cefalu is generally a little warmer than Santander. Daily temperatures in Cefalu average around 19°C (67°F), and Santander fluctuates around 16°C (60°F).

Cefalu usually receives more sunshine than Santander during autumn. Cefalu gets 189 hours of sunny skies, while Santander receives 133 hours of full sun in the autumn.

Santander receives a lot of rain in the autumn. In October, Cefalu usually receives less rain than Santander. Cefalu gets 75 mm (2.9 in) of rain, while Santander receives 138 mm (5.4 in) of rain each month for the autumn.

Should I visit Cefalu or Santander in the Winter?

The winter brings many poeple to Cefalu as well as Santander. Most visitors come to Cefalu for the museums, the shopping scene, and the cuisine during these months.

Cefalu is a little warmer than Santander in the winter. The daily temperature in Cefalu averages around 10°C (51°F) in January, and Santander fluctuates around 9°C (49°F).

In the winter, Cefalu often gets more sunshine than Santander. Cefalu gets 153 hours of sunny skies this time of year, while Santander receives 91 hours of full sun.

It's quite rainy in Santander. Cefalu usually gets less rain in January than Santander. Cefalu gets 59 mm (2.3 in) of rain, while Santander receives 149 mm (5.9 in) of rain this time of the year.

Should I visit Cefalu or Santander in the Spring?

Both Santander and Cefalu are popular destinations to visit in the spring with plenty of activities. The spring months attract visitors to Cefalu because of the beaches, the small town charm, and the natural beauty.

In the spring, Cefalu is a little warmer than Santander. Typically, the spring temperatures in Cefalu in April average around 15°C (58°F), and Santander averages at about 12°C (53°F).

The sun comes out a lot this time of the year in Cefalu. Cefalu usually receives more sunshine than Santander during spring. Cefalu gets 204 hours of sunny skies, while Santander receives 148 hours of full sun in the spring.

It rains a lot this time of the year in Santander. In April, Cefalu usually receives less rain than Santander. Cefalu gets 36 mm (1.4 in) of rain, while Santander receives 135 mm (5.3 in) of rain each month for the spring.

Typical Weather for Santander and Cefalu

Cefalu Santander
Temp (°C) Rain (mm) Temp (°C) Rain (mm)
Jan 10°C (51°F) 59 mm (2.3 in) 9°C (49°F) 149 mm (5.9 in)
Feb 11°C (52°F) 47 mm (1.9 in) 10°C (50°F) 116 mm (4.6 in)
Mar 12°C (54°F) 30 mm (1.2 in) 10°C (51°F) 119 mm (4.7 in)
Apr 15°C (58°F) 36 mm (1.4 in) 12°C (53°F) 135 mm (5.3 in)
May 19°C (65°F) 23 mm (0.9 in) 14°C (58°F) 94 mm (3.7 in)
Jun 23°C (73°F) 6 mm (0.2 in) 17°C (62°F) 63 mm (2.5 in)
Jul 26°C (79°F) 2 mm (0.1 in) 19°C (66°F) 50 mm (2 in)
Aug 26°C (79°F) 14 mm (0.5 in) 19°C (67°F) 89 mm (3.5 in)
Sep 24°C (74°F) 37 mm (1.5 in) 18°C (64°F) 88 mm (3.4 in)
Oct 19°C (67°F) 75 mm (2.9 in) 16°C (60°F) 138 mm (5.4 in)
Nov 15°C (59°F) 49 mm (1.9 in) 12°C (53°F) 181 mm (7.1 in)
Dec 12°C (53°F) 68 mm (2.7 in) 10°C (50°F) 157 mm (6.2 in)
